About 2D-3D Mall
The 2D-3D Mall is a cutting-edge virtual shopping platform designed to revolutionize eCommerce. Blending 2D and 3D metaverse environments, it provides an immersive and interactive experience for shoppers. Our client aimed to create a seamless digital marketplace where users can explore virtual stores, try products, and make purchases, bridging the gap between physical and online retail. The platform offers an engaging, scalable solution for businesses to connect with customers in a futuristic, virtual shopping world.

Overview
This is a cutting-edge virtual shopping platform that bridges the gap between traditional e-commerce and the emerging metaverse. It allows customers to buy products and businesses to create virtual stores in both 2D and 3D environments. Users can create customizable avatars to browse stores, try on items virtually, and interact with businesses in real-time, providing a unique and immersive shopping experience.
Challenges
1. Dual Environment Management:
2D and 3D Metaverse Integration: The platform needed to manage both 2D and 3D environments simultaneously, ensuring seamless transitions and interactions without technical issues.
High Traffic Handling: The platform had to handle large amounts of traffic, particularly in the 3D environment, without experiencing slow loading times, order processing delays, or scalability issues.
2. User Experience:
Avatar Creation and Interaction: Providing a smooth and engaging avatar creation process that allows users to express their individuality and interact with businesses and other customers in the virtual world.
Secure and Trustworthy Shopping: In a competitive e-commerce landscape, building user trust through a hassle-free shopping experience and secure payment options was crucial.
Solutions
1. Dual Environment Management:
Separate Servers for 2D and 3D: We deployed separate servers for the 2D and 3D environments. The 2D interface utilized a standard server optimized for light browsing and product information, while the 3D environment was hosted on a powerful server to manage the more complex and resource-intensive requirements of the metaverse.
Unity Engine for 3D Development :
High-Performance Rendering: We chose the Unity engine to develop the 3D metaverse environment, ensuring smooth rendering of graphics and handling of complex 3D elements, even during peak traffic times.
Scalability and Reliability: The use of dedicated, strong servers for 3D elements prevented resource overload, maintaining consistent performance across both the 2D and 3D experiences.
2. Enhanced User Experience:
Avatar Customization :
Ready Me Player Plugin: To enable users to customize their avatars, we integrated the Ready Me Player plugin. This tool offers a wide range of customization options, allowing users to select clothing, hairstyles, accessories, and more to create avatars that truly represent their personal style.
Real-Time Interaction: The avatars allow users to interact with businesses and other customers in real-time, enhancing the overall engagement and experience within the platform.
User-Friendly Interface :
Interactive and Intuitive Design: We designed a user-friendly, easy-to-navigate interface that facilitates a smooth shopping experience. Users can quickly find stores, search for specific items, and complete purchases without frustration.
Secure Payment Options: To build trust, we implemented secure payment gateways that protect user data and ensure safe transactions.
Implementation Details
Technical Architecture : The platform's technical architecture was carefully designed to support the dual environment, with separate but integrated backend systems for 2D and 3D functionalities.
Performance Optimization: We optimized performance to ensure quick loading times, even in the graphics-intensive 3D environment, and to support real-time interactions without lag.
Security Protocols: Advanced security measures were put in place to protect user data, including encryption for transactions and secure server communication.
Testing and Quality Assurance: Extensive testing was conducted across both environments to identify and fix potential issues, ensuring a smooth and reliable user experience from launch.
Results
Seamless Dual Environment: The platform successfully manages both 2D and 3D environments, offering a seamless and immersive shopping experience to users.
High User Engagement: The avatar customization feature and real-time interactions have significantly increased user engagement and satisfaction.
Scalability and Performance: The platform handles high traffic efficiently without compromising performance, supporting a growing user base as iKon Mall continues to expand.
Trust and Security: The secure payment options and intuitive interface have built user trust, leading to a higher conversion rate and repeat customers.
Technology Stack
-
Frontend
-
Mongo DB
-
Node JS